Common Services Offered in Reproductive Endocrinology

Reproductive endocrinology is a medical specialty that deals with infertility, menopause, and other conditions involving reproductive hormones. The medical specialists in this field are called reproductive endocrinologists. The main focus of reproductive endocrinology Bedford is on hormonal issues that affect infertility but can also attend to other reproductive problems. Endocrinologists can diagnose and treat reproductive disorders in both genders that cause infertility. 

These providers can also assist obstetricians and gynecologists in prenatal and postnatal issues. Reproductive endocrinology provides many medical services, including:

Diagnostic tests

Before reproductive endocrinologists develop a treatment plan, the providers must find the cause of your condition. Diagnosis may include a check for thyroid disorders, semen tests, and a uterus and fallopian tubes X-ray to check for structural problems. Ovarian reserve fertility tests can measure the level of various hormones related to reproduction, such as follicle stimulating, estradiol, and anti-Müllerian hormones.

Surgical treatments

Reproductive endocrinologists perform many surgeries, such as abdominal myomectomy, to remove non-cancerous growths in the uterus. These providers can do surgeries to unblock fallopian tubes or other operations to correct structural issues causing infertility. Endocrinologists can also perform surgeries in men to unblock reproductive ducts to allow sperm passage.

Give hormone treatments

During assisted reproductive technology, your doctor may include hormone treatment to help you carry your baby to term. Hormones can also treat particular infertility causes like polycystic ovarian syndrome. During menopause, endocrinologists can use hormone replacement therapy to reduce menopausal symptoms. Sometimes hormone treatment can be used to improve your sexual development.

Infertility treatments

Your endocrinologist offers infertility treatment depending on the cause. It may involve medications, hormone therapy, or assisted reproductive technology (ART). ART involves various treatments, including intrauterine insemination, where your doctor collects sperm and places them in a woman’s uterus for fertilization. This technique can be beneficial when a man has ejaculation disorders. 

In vitro fertilization is another ART technique that is commonly used. This procedure involves your endocrinologist fertilizing an ovum with sperm in a laboratory and transferring the best embryo to the mother or surrogate’s uterus.

Fertility preservation

Fertility preservation involves saving sperm, eggs, or embryos for future use. You can have fertility preservation if you have a problem, treatment, or experience that can affect your fertility. For example, you can have your eggs, sperm, or embryos frozen before cancer treatment. Doctors can also preserve eggs or sperm if you have surgeries concerning your reproductive parts.

Attend to menstrual disorders

Menstrual disorders can include heavy or irregular periods. Polycystic ovarian syndrome, perimenopause, thyroid diseases, medications, uterine fibroids, and contraceptive methods can lead to menstrual disorders. Your endocrinologist can diagnose the source of your problem and create a treatment plan for you. Reducing weight and treating underlying conditions like thyroid disease can help normalize your periods.

Treat low sperm count

Low sperm count can result from cystic fibrosis, blockage of sperm flow, uncontrolled diabetes, certain medications, and high prolactin levels. Treating underlying conditions and hormone therapy can help increase sperm count. Your doctor can recommend an intra-cytoplasmic injection if a pregnancy is desired. Finding the Best Skin Cancer Clinic Sunshine Coast: A Comprehensive Guide

The Sunshine Coast, with its pleasant climate and stunning beaches, is an idyllic destination. However, due to the Sunshine Coast’s increased risk of skin cancer due to excessive sunshine exposure, finding an appropriate skin cancer clinic on this coast is crucial for early detection, treatment and prevention of skin disease. We will guide you through the process of finding the best skin cancer clinic sunshine coast like Sundoctors so that you find a clinic with your best interests at heart. 

Research: As your first step to finding the best skin cancer clinic on the Sunshine Coast, research should be your top priority. Here’s what to keep in mind when conducting your investigation:

Online Reviews: Search engines such as Google can be an effective way to quickly and efficiently locate skin cancer clinics on the Sunshine Coast region. When using search engines like this one, look for clinics with excellent patient reviews and high ratings from customers.

Ask for Recommendations: Reach out to friends, family members or colleagues with experience at skin cancer clinics nearby who may provide invaluable recommendations. Personal recommendations can provide invaluable insight.

Examine Medical Directories: When researching skin cancer clinics, consult medical directories and websites that list healthcare providers such as skin cancer clinics. Such directories typically contain information regarding their location, services offered, and contact details for the clinic in question.

Consider Distance: Take into account where the clinic is located relative to your home or workplace when selecting one for regular check-ups. A clinic that’s easy to get to will make scheduling regular visits much simpler.

Once you have compiled a list of clinics, it is vitally important that you assess their credentials. Here’s what to keep an eye out for:

Qualified Dermatologists: Make sure the clinic employs qualified dermatologists or healthcare providers with expertise in skin cancer detection and treatment, such as board-certified dermatologists. Dermatologists are specifically trained to care for skin ailments.

Accreditation: Before selecting any clinic, verify its accreditation by relevant medical associations or organizations. Accreditation shows a commitment to high-quality care while adhering to industry standards.

Examine Clinic Services: Different skin cancer clinics may provide various services. In order to choose one best suited to your needs, consider these factors when searching for one:

Comprehensive Skin Checks: When shopping for clinics that provide comprehensive skin exams, including dermoscopy – a non-invasive technique using specialized equipment to examine moles and lesions on your skin in detail – be wary.

Biopsy Services: Make sure the clinic can perform skin biopsies as required – these tests are an essential tool in accurately diagnosing skin cancer.

Explore Treatment Options: Explore all available treatment options available through your clinic, such as surgical excision, cryotherapy, photodynamic therapy (PDT) and topical creams for less aggressive skin cancers.

Reputation: Is Essential Evaluation is key when choosing a clinic; here’s how you can evaluate it:

Read Reviews: When looking for clinics online, reading patient reviews and testimonials can provide invaluable insight into their quality of care and patient satisfaction levels.

Reach Out: As previously discussed, seeking recommendations from those you can rely on can provide much-needed reassurance. Hearing about positive experiences shared by friends or family members can provide welcome relief from anxiety.

Evaluation of Convenience: Convenience should also be an essential consideration when selecting a skin cancer clinic:

Location: Consider where the clinic is in relation to your home or workplace when selecting one, as a convenient location will make attending appointments and follow-up visits much simpler.

Operating Hours: Before making an appointment at any clinic, check its operating hours to make sure they work with your schedule. Some facilities offer extended hours or weekend appointments.

Cost and Insurance: Affordability should always be at the forefront when making decisions regarding healthcare, so here’s what to keep in mind when making healthcare choices:

Cost of Services: Find out the costs associated with skin checks, biopsies, and treatments as well as payment options available such as insurance coverage, out-of-pocket expenses, or payment plans.

Insurance Acceptance: When selecting a clinic that accepts health insurance, this could have a major impact on both the selection process and cost of care.

Enquire About Follow-up Care: Effective skin cancer management typically requires ongoing surveillance and follow-up appointments
